The size of Belmore is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. It has 12 parks covering nearly 4.9% of total area. The population of Belmore in 2016 was 12718 people. By 2021 the population was 13781 showing a population growth of 8.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Belmore is 30-39 years. Households in Belmore are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Belmore work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 52.90% of the homes in Belmore were owner-occupied compared with 52.90% in 2016.
